MCP Server Microsoft365 Filesearch
什麼是Microsoft 365 文件搜索服務器?
這是一款基於Model Context Protocol (MCP)的服務器,允許您快速搜索Microsoft 365中的文件,例如在SharePoint和OneDrive中查找特定內容。它可以幫助您分析文件的元數據並輕鬆整合到您的工作流程中。如何使用Microsoft 365 文件搜索服務器?
只需輸入搜索關鍵詞即可找到需要的文件。服務器會返回文件的元數據和內容摘要,您可以進一步獲取文件的具體內容。適用場景
該服務器非常適合企業用戶需要快速檢索文件、分析文件內容或集成文件管理功能的場景。主要功能
高級文件搜索根據關鍵詞搜索Microsoft 365中的文件,返回文件的元數據和內容摘要。
本地緩存機制下載的文件會存儲在本地緩存中,方便後續快速訪問,提升效率。
無縫集成工作流將文件搜索結果直接集成到現有業務流程中,提高工作效率。
優勢與侷限性
優勢
快速檢索文件,節省時間。
支持本地緩存,減少重複API調用。
簡單易用,無需複雜配置。
支持多種文件格式和內容分析。
侷限性
需要Azure註冊的應用程序權限。
對大文件可能需要更長的處理時間。
依賴於Microsoft Graph API,網絡連接需穩定。
如何使用
安裝並運行服務器
確保已安裝Python環境,並克隆GitHub倉庫到本地。
配置環境變量
設置必要的環境變量,包括客戶端ID、客戶端密鑰和租戶ID。
啟動服務器
在項目目錄下運行服務器腳本。
使用搜索功能
輸入關鍵詞進行文件搜索,獲取文件元數據。
使用案例
案例標題:搜索年度報告輸入關鍵詞‘年度報告’,獲取符合條件的文件列表。
案例標題:獲取具體文件內容通過文件ID和驅動器ID獲取文件的具體內容。
常見問題
如何註冊Azure應用程序?
搜索速度慢怎麼辦?
文件緩存在哪裡存儲?
相關資源
GitHub 項目地址
查看項目源碼和文檔。
Microsoft Graph API 文檔
瞭解Microsoft Graph API的相關功能。
Azure 註冊教程
快速上手Azure應用註冊。
精選MCP服務推薦

Baidu Map
已認證
百度地圖MCP Server是國內首個兼容MCP協議的地圖服務,提供地理編碼、路線規劃等10個標準化API接口,支持Python和Typescript快速接入,賦能智能體實現地圖相關功能。
Python
702
4.5分

Markdownify MCP
Markdownify是一個多功能文件轉換服務,支持將PDF、圖片、音頻等多種格式及網頁內容轉換為Markdown格式。
TypeScript
1.7K
5分

Firecrawl MCP Server
Firecrawl MCP Server是一個集成Firecrawl網頁抓取能力的模型上下文協議服務器,提供豐富的網頁抓取、搜索和內容提取功能。
TypeScript
3.8K
5分

Sequential Thinking MCP Server
一個基於MCP協議的結構化思維服務器,通過定義思考階段幫助分解複雜問題並生成總結
Python
258
4.5分

Notion Api MCP
已認證
一個基於Python的MCP服務器,通過Notion API提供高級待辦事項管理和內容組織功能,實現AI模型與Notion的無縫集成。
Python
119
4.5分

Edgeone Pages MCP Server
EdgeOne Pages MCP是一個通過MCP協議快速部署HTML內容到EdgeOne Pages並獲取公開URL的服務
TypeScript
249
4.8分

Context7
Context7 MCP是一個為AI編程助手提供即時、版本特定文檔和代碼示例的服務,通過Model Context Protocol直接集成到提示中,解決LLM使用過時信息的問題。
TypeScript
5.2K
4.7分

Magic MCP
Magic Component Platform (MCP) 是一個AI驅動的UI組件生成工具,通過自然語言描述幫助開發者快速創建現代化UI組件,支持多種IDE集成。
JavaScript
1.7K
5分